CME Group Inc. (CME) Earnings Overview

As of May 6, 2026, CME Group Inc. (CME) reported trailing twelve-month net income of $4.24B, reflecting +15.4% year-over-year growth. The company earned $11.68 per diluted share over the past four quarters, with a net profit margin of 62.0%.

Looking at the long-term picture, CME's 5-year EPS compound annual growth rate (CAGR) stands at +13.7%, showing solid earnings momentum. The company achieved its highest annual net income of $4.06B in fiscal 2017.

CME Group Inc. maintains industry-leading profitability with a gross margin of 86.1%, operating margin of 64.9%, and net margin of 62.0%. This margin structure demonstrates strong pricing power and operational efficiency. View revenue history →

Compared to peers including ICE ($3.30B net income, 26.1% margin), CBOE ($1.10B net income, 23.3% margin), NDAQ ($1.91B net income, 21.8% margin), CME has outperformed on profitability metrics. Compare CME vs ICE →

CME Historical Earnings Data (2000–2025)

26 years
Fiscal Year Net Income YoY % Operating Income EPS (Diluted) Net Margin Op. Margin
2025$4.04B+14.7%$4.23B$11.1662.0%64.9%
2024$3.53B+9.3%$3.93B$9.6757.5%64.1%
2023$3.23B+19.9%$3.44B$8.8657.8%61.6%
2022$2.69B+2.1%$3.02B$7.4053.6%60.1%
2021$2.64B+25.2%$2.65B$7.2956.2%56.4%
2020$2.11B-0.5%$2.64B$5.8743.1%54.0%
2019$2.12B+7.9%$2.59B$5.9143.5%53.2%
2018$1.96B-51.7%$2.61B$5.7145.5%60.5%
2017$4.06B+164.9%$2.31B$11.94111.5%63.4%
2016$1.53B+23.0%$2.20B$4.5342.7%61.2%
